Painting Description
"On The Outskirts Of A Town" by William Taverner is a notable work of art that captures the essence of rural life in 18th-century England. William Taverner, an English artist known for his landscape paintings, created this piece during a period when the appreciation for natural scenery was burgeoning among the British public. Taverner's work is often celebrated for its detailed and realistic portrayal of the countryside, and "On The Outskirts Of A Town" is no exception.
The painting depicts a serene and picturesque scene on the edge of a small town, where the hustle and bustle of urban life gradually gives way to the tranquility of the countryside. Taverner's use of light and shadow, along with his meticulous attention to detail, brings the landscape to life, inviting viewers to step into the scene and experience the calmness and beauty of rural England.
In "On The Outskirts Of A Town," Taverner employs a palette of soft, earthy tones that enhance the naturalistic feel of the painting. The composition is carefully balanced, with elements such as trees, fields, and buildings arranged harmoniously to guide the viewer's eye through the scene. The painting not only showcases Taverner's technical skill but also reflects the 18th-century Romantic movement's fascination with nature and the pastoral ideal.
Taverner's work, including "On The Outskirts Of A Town," has been influential in the development of landscape painting in England. His ability to capture the subtleties of the natural world and his dedication to portraying the beauty of the English countryside have earned him a lasting place in the history of art. This painting remains a testament to Taverner's talent and his contribution to the genre of landscape painting.
